Dmitri Aleksandrovich Chernykh (Russian: Дмитрий Александрович Черных; born February 27, 1985) is a Russian former professional ice hockey forward who played in the Kontinental Hockey League (KHL).
[2] Chernykh developed in the Khimik Voskresensk hockey system, the club his father also played for.
He was a member of Russia's U18 national team, but struggled to make the U20 squad in the following years.
Chernykh has primarily spent time skating in Russia's second- and third-tier leagues, struggling to break back into the KHL.
